Came last night to see a Copa America game, and we made a reservation for 8 people. When I arrived - I assumed the girl at the door was the hostess and asked about our table, but she directed me to another man. He had no idea of the reservations and passed me along to the waitresses, who individually bounced me around from table to table unsure where I was allowed to sit. Their ā€œreservation systemā€ was to write ā€œReservedā€ on a napkin with someone’s name, and everytime one waitress would sit me down, another would come behind her and say it was reserved. Basically no one had any idea what to do with a reservation, and just kept bumping me off a table to be safe despite me repeatedly saying I have a reservation so one of these should be for me. Thankfully there were two very helpful waitresses who tried to sort it out for me, and basically said - this one must be your table because it’s for 8 and has no name. (it was very clearly a table of 4 but at that point I was just tired of jumping around). My party was running late because it was raining, and by the time the last two got there, the bouncer had decided that it was at capacity despite the very obvious empty chairs all over (and empty floor space). When I tell you absolutely no one could help us get two people into a bar that had space, despite having two empty chairs. The waitress tried twice, we were trying to reason with him, and finally they called the ā€œmanagerā€, two men who I hadn’t seen the entire evening and who did absolutely nothing. We ended up giving up and leaving without paying for any of the drinks and food we had already ordered (mind you, we had been there 2 hours already and ordered ahead for our friends that were on the way). The worst part is that the restaurant staff didn’t even fight us on paying for the stuff, because they knew it was ridiculous. You could see the waitresses pissed off and pointing to the empty chairs at their tables for all the guests the bouncer wouldn’t let in because of ā€œcapacityā€. Shout out to those two specific waitresses (I didn’t get their names but they had black curly hair), who deserve promotions over those useless managers who were MIA on an obviously busy night, and then completely useless when they did appear. I have been to 3308 Eats N Drinks many many times before the pandemic and today was the first time back since then. As a party of three we walked in and it was dead inside something we rarely saw before on a Thursday night. We sat at the bar and proceeded to ordering, The drinks were decent but extremely over priced (Ask before you order or order at your own risk) food was alright to be honest their french fries were the best thing we had there. We ordered their wings and they were dried and not really good like before. I believe they have changed management because the people that use to work there were no longer there it was all new faces. Not saying the new faces were bad they were very friendly and nice but my god when it came to closing out and paying we got a shocking bill. That's why I am advising for you to ask before you order. Beware that even though you sit at the bar the bartenders will automatically add a gratuity to your closing bill. An alright place not worth the money. You can go to other much better and affordable bar/restaurant places in Astoria. At the bottom of the receipt it states that a 20% GRATUITY FEE will apply for a party of 5 or more and mind you it was only 3 of us at the bar not even at a table. This past Sunday I went to 3308 to have a drink with my friends. If I could give this place 0 stars I would but that’s not the option. Which sucks because the Dj was very good and kept up there for a little over 90 min. When the server came around we ordered our drinks and 2/3 drinks were incorrect. Not only that we had to wait an excessive time to get our drinks, there was no sense of urgency to serve us and the establishment was not busy. Our server name was Alexandra, She upcharged us for top shelf liquor that we didn’t order. She was rude and and argued that this what was requested(when my two friends don’t even drink VSOP). I don’t understand how specific you can get when you ask for a henny ginger ale. Also we were offered complimentary tacos on Sunday special I guess and our tacos were ate in the kitchen because we never received them. Shortly after speaking with management it was obvious that this is what this establishment tells their servers to upcharge if you don’t specify. They did not try to solve our issue, he made it seem like we were drunk only after 1 round of drinks and two shots. On the bottom of the receipt it states if your bill is over 100 they add automatic grat And I’m just gonna assume this is why they try to sell their top shelf to get to the point quicker. As a bartender I understand we are there to make our business money and ourselves but this is absolutely unacceptable. It was never about the money just principal. Will never return to that spot ever again.

The music and vibe at this place were great, but unfortunately, the service left a lot to be desired. The staff came across as dismissive, and it felt like they didn’t care much,probably because gratuity is automatically included. One major issue is the lack of transparency when it comes to billing. Gratuity is supposed to be added only to checks over $100, yet ours was under that and still had gratuity included without it being mentioned. On top of that, there were multiple extra charges, including a service fee,even though I paid in cash. That felt like a total scam. We ordered two Don Julio Blanco sodas and were charged $44( $22 per drink) what!!!. I don’t mind paying a premium when it’s for a thoughtfully crafted cocktail, but this was just a basic tequila soda, and the quality was poor & soda was flat . To make things worse, we were told we had to buy a bottle just to sit down, even though the place was empty. Expecting guests to finish a full bottle between two people just to get a table doesn’t make any sense. Overall, I wouldn’t recommend this spot. It’s overpriced, not guest-friendly, and lacks transparency. There are definitely better places out there that value their customers more. Try Rabbit hole, or other joints around the area!
